Menorah in Flames (Serbian), also known as the Monument to Jewish Victims of Nazi Genocide in Belgrade and Serbia, is a Holocaust memorial in Belgrade, Serbia. Designed by sculptor and Holocaust survivor Nandor Glid, it was unveiled on 21 October 1990 on the Danube riverbank in the Dorćol neighbourhood, the historic Jewish quarter of the city. It commemorates the Jewish victims of the Holocaust in German-occupied Serbia.
